--- Comment #41 from Caio Lima <ticaiolima at gmail.com> ---
Hi Guys,
I am trying to inline the customs getter function call but I am facing a weird error.
When I set the cache Up, I put into pc[5] the pointer of the Custom Function "GetValueFunc".
When I try to load it into a register in LowLevelInterpreter64.asm, its content is not the same. I am doing the following operations:
loadisFromInstruction(5, t1)
PrepareForCCall
//load the arguments
cCall4(t0)
//retrun retrieving and dispatch
I debugged the value present into t1 (in my architecture is the rsi) and it is not corresponding to the pointer setted in setup. To test if call was working, I manually set rsi with the value of the function address and the function was called, however some arguments were incorrect the pointers.
I tried load the function pointer using:
loadpFromInstruction(5, t1)
And had no success too.
Is anything I am doing wrong to get the pc[] elements as pointer?
